Best Five Oaks Public Schools (2025-26)

For the 2025-26 school year, there are 2 public schools serving 1,058 students in the neighborhood of Five Oaks, Dayton, OH.
The top-ranked public schools in Five Oaks are Deca Prep and Gem City Career Prep High School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
The neighborhood of Five Oaks, Dayton, OH public schools have an average math proficiency score of 24% (versus the Ohio public school average of 55%), and reading proficiency score of 35% (versus the 60% statewide average).
Minority enrollment is 98% of the student body (majority Black), which is more than the Ohio public school average of 34% (majority Black).
